As part of the local authority’s three year 3.5 million Frontline First Fund, environmental hit squads have been working across the area clearing up.

As part of the local authority’s three year 3.5 million Frontline First Fund, environmental hit squads have been working across the area clearing up footpaths, cutting back hedges, weeding, cleaning high-footfall pavements and street furniture, and undertaking other environmental improvement works.
